| #pragma once |
| #define TEMPORAL_NOISE_SHAPING_MAX_ORDER (12) |
| #define TEMPORAL_NOISE_SHAPING_MAX_ORDER_SHORT (5) |
| #define TEMPORAL_NOISE_SHAPING_START_FREQ (1275) |
| #define TEMPORAL_NOISE_SHAPING_START_FREQ_SHORT (2750) |
| #define TEMPORAL_NOISE_SHAPING_COEF_RES (4) |
| #define TEMPORAL_NOISE_SHAPING_COEF_RES_SHORT (3) |
| #define FILTER_DIRECTION (0) |
| #define PI_BY_1000 (0.00314159265358979323f) |
| #define TEMPORAL_NOISE_SHAPING_MODIFY_BEGIN 2600 /* Hz */ |
| #define RATIO_PATCH_LOWER_BORDER 380 /* Hz */ |
| #define INT_BITS 32 |
| typedef struct { |
| WORD32 channel_bit_rate; |
| WORD32 bandwidth_mono; |
| WORD32 bandwidth_stereo; |
| } ixheaace_bandwidth_table; |
| typedef struct { |
| FLOAT32 thresh_on; |
| WORD32 lpc_start_freq; |
| WORD32 lpc_stop_freq; |
| FLOAT32 tns_time_resolution; |
| } ixheaace_temporal_noise_shaping_config_tabulated; |
| |
| typedef struct { |
| WORD8 tns_active; |
| WORD32 tns_max_sfb; |
| WORD32 max_order; |
| WORD32 tns_start_freq; |
| WORD32 coef_res; |
| ixheaace_temporal_noise_shaping_config_tabulated conf_tab; |
| FLOAT32 acf_window_float[TEMPORAL_NOISE_SHAPING_MAX_ORDER + 1]; |
| WORD32 tns_start_band; |
| WORD32 tns_start_line; |
| WORD32 tns_stop_band; |
| WORD32 tns_stop_line; |
| WORD32 lpc_start_band; |
| WORD32 lpc_start_line; |
| WORD32 lpc_stop_band; |
| WORD32 lpc_stop_line; |
| WORD32 tns_ratio_patch_lowest_cb; |
| WORD32 tns_modify_begin_cb; |
| FLOAT32 threshold; |
| } ixheaace_temporal_noise_shaping_config; |
| |
| typedef struct { |
| WORD8 tns_active; |
| FLOAT32 parcor[TEMPORAL_NOISE_SHAPING_MAX_ORDER]; |
| FLOAT32 prediction_gain; |
| } ixheaace_temporal_noise_shaping_subblock_info_long; |
| |
| typedef struct { |
| WORD8 tns_active; |
| FLOAT32 parcor[TEMPORAL_NOISE_SHAPING_MAX_ORDER]; |
| FLOAT32 prediction_gain; |
| } ixheaace_temporal_noise_shaping_subblock_info_short; |
| |
| typedef struct { |
| ixheaace_temporal_noise_shaping_subblock_info_short sub_block_info[TRANS_FAC]; |
| } ixheaace_temporal_noise_shaping_data_short; |
| |
| typedef struct { |
| ixheaace_temporal_noise_shaping_subblock_info_long sub_block_info; |
| } ixheaace_temporal_noise_shaping_data_long; |
| |
| typedef struct { |
| ixheaace_temporal_noise_shaping_data_long tns_data_long; |
| ixheaace_temporal_noise_shaping_data_short tns_data_short; |
| } ixheaace_temporal_noise_shaping_data_raw; |
| |
| typedef struct { |
| WORD32 numOfSubblocks; |
| ixheaace_temporal_noise_shaping_data_raw data_raw; |
| } ixheaace_temporal_noise_shaping_data; |
| |
| typedef struct { |
| WORD8 tns_active[TRANS_FAC]; |
| WORD8 coef_res[TRANS_FAC]; |
| WORD32 length[TRANS_FAC]; |
| WORD32 order[TRANS_FAC]; |
| WORD32 coef[TRANS_FAC * TEMPORAL_NOISE_SHAPING_MAX_ORDER_SHORT]; |
| } ixheaace_temporal_noise_shaping_params; |
